Як налаштувати винагороду за голоси для вашого сервера Hytale

By HytaleCharts Team Category: guides 8 min read

Дізнайтеся, як підключити ваш сервер Hytale до HytaleCharts і автоматично винагороджувати гравців, які голосують. Охоплює Votifier V2, V1, HTTP callbacks та інтеграцію з магазином PixlPay.

Голоси - це валюта у списку серверів Hytale. Чим більше голосів заробляє ваш сервер, тим вище він посідає в рейтингу - і тим більше гравців його відкривають. Але голоси не з'являються просто так. Гравцям потрібна причина, щоб повертатися щодня і натискати цю кнопку. Ось тут і з'являються винагороди за голоси. HytaleCharts підтримує кілька способів сповіщення вашого сервера Hytale про те, що гравець проголосував, тож ви можете автоматично доставляти внутрішньоігрові предмети, валюту, звання чи будь-що інше, чого вимагає економіка вашого сервера. У цьому посібнику розглянуто всі варіанти інтеграції: Votifier V2, Votifier V1, HTTP Votifier, загальні веб-хуки та інтеграція з вітриною магазину PixlPay. Чому важливі винагороди за голоси Сервери зі списку Hytale, які пропонують винагороду за голоси, постійно перевершують ті, що її не пропонують. Логіка проста: Щодня утримання: Гравці повертаються кожні 24 години, щоб проголосувати і забрати свою винагороду Вищий рейтинг: Більша кількість голосів піднімає ваш сервер вище в списку, збільшуючи видимість серед нових гравців Задоволеність гравців: Безкоштовні ігрові предмети створюють доброзичливість і залучають випадкових гравців Конкурентна перевага: топові сервери Hytale майже повсюдно пропонують заохочення за голосування Як працює потік повідомлень про голосування Перш ніж зануритися в налаштування, варто зрозуміти, як HytaleCharts доставляє дані про голосування на ваш сервер: Перш ніж зануритися в налаштування, варто зрозуміти, як HytaleCharts доставляє дані про голосування на ваш сервер Гравець Голоси гравців на сторінці HytaleCharts вашого сервера Голос записується в базу даних, і кількість голосів на вашому сервері збільшується Повідомлення надіслано - HytaleCharts надсилає ім'я користувача та метадані голосувальника на ваш сервер за допомогою налаштованого вами протоколу Ваш плагін отримує голос і запускає будь-яку логіку винагороди, яку ви налаштували Гравець отримує винагороду у грі, або негайно (якщо він онлайн), або при наступному вході На етапі сповіщення варіанти інтеграції відрізняються. Кожен протокол надсилає однакові основні дані - хто і коли проголосував - але використовує різні транспортні механізми. Варіант 1: NuVotifier V2 (рекомендований) NuVotifier V2 - це рекомендований протокол для підключення вашого сервера Hytale до HytaleCharts. Він використовує повідомлення з підписом HMAC-SHA256 через TCP-сокет з рукостисканням "виклик-відповідь", що робить його найбільш безпечним з доступних варіантів. Як це працює HytaleCharts підключається до порту Votifier вашого сервера (зазвичай 8192) Ваш сервер надсилає рядок виклику HytaleCharts підписує корисне навантаження голосу вашим спільним секретним токеном Ваш сервер перевіряє підпис перед обробкою Повторні атаки запобігаються завдяки унікальному виклику для кожного з'єднання Кроки налаштування Встановіть плагін Votifier на вашому сервері Hytale (HyVotifier, HyVote або сумісний) Відкрийте конфігураційний файл плагіна та зверніть увагу на токен та порт На HytaleCharts перейдіть до Сервер редагування → Інтеграція Votifier Увімкніть Votifier і виберіть "NuVotifier (V2) - Рекомендовано" Введіть хост вашого сервера (наприклад, play.yourserver.com), порт (наприклад, 8192) та токен Натисніть "Перевірити з'єднання", щоб перевірити рукостискання Натисніть "Надіслати тестовий голос", щоб підтвердити наскрізну доставку Збережіть налаштування Що вам знадобиться ПолеДе знайти ХостПублічна IP-адреса або домен вашого сервера ПортФайл конфігурації плагіна (за замовчуванням: 8192) ТокенФайл конфігурації плагіна (спільний секрет)